Published on 31 May 2024 on Zacks via Yahoo Finance
CommScope Holding Company, Inc. COMM has significantly strengthened its portfolio by acquiring Casa Systems' Cable Business assets. Under a court-supervised Chapter 11 process, Casa Systems selected CommScope as the highest and best bidder, finalizing a $45.1 million purchase agreement on May 29, 2024. The deal, conducted under section 363 of the Bankruptcy Code, is scheduled for a sale hearing on Jun 4, with the transaction expected to close by Jun 6.This acquisition enhances CommScope’s market-leading position in Access Network Solutions. It bolsters its virtual CMTS (Cable Modem Termination Systems) and PON (Passive Optical Network) product offerings, bringing significant synergies to the company’s operations. This move aligns with CommScope's strategy to expand its technological capabilities and customer base, especially in the domain of cloud-native network solutions.From an industry perspective, this acquisition is pivotal as it allows CommScope to integrate Casa's advanced technologies into its own portfolio. The enhanced product offerings will enable CommScope to provide more comprehensive solutions, catering to the growing demand for high-speed, reliable network connectivity. The incorporation of Casa’s technologies is expected to facilitate a smoother transition for customers to Distributed Access Architecture solutions, a critical component in modernizing cable networks.Moreover, the deal holds significant importance for CommScope from a business standpoint. The company views the acquisition as a means to ensure stability for Casa’s existing customers while simultaneously expanding its market reach. By offering a seamless integration of CMTS products, CommScope aims to enhance customer satisfaction and loyalty. The expected synergies and expanded product offerings underscore the strategic value of this transaction, marking a significant milestone in CommScope's ongoing growth and innovation journey.With operators moving toward converged or multi-use network structures, combining voice, video and data communications into a single network, CommScope is dedicatedly developing solutions designed to support wireline and wireless network convergence, which will be essential for the success of 5G technology. Its product portfolio has been specifically designed to help global service providers efficiently deploy fiber networks. This augurs well for its long-term growth prospects.
